Berkshire Hathaway has further slashed its stake in HP Inc, bringing down its cumulative shareholding in the computer and printer-maker to 5.2 percent, as per a regulatory filing released by billionaire Warren Buffet's investing giant late on December 11.

At the end of November, Berkshire owned 51.5 million shares of HP, according to the filing submitted before the US Securities and Exchange Commission. The stake is worth around $1.6 billion, as per the last closing price of $30.37 per share.

Berkshire has halved its stake in HP as compared to September-end, when it owned 102.5 million shares, equivalent to 10 percent of the overall stake.

The Omaha-based investment conglomerate had begun reducing its bet from June onwards, when it held 121 million shares, equivalent to about 12 percent stake, in the tech firm.
